Abstract

The annual increase in the number of criminal offenses committed against the sexual integrity of minors gives rise to the need to strengthen state policy in the field of protecting the rights and freedoms of minors in the country. Despite the adoption of a number of documents at the international and national level in the field of protecting and ensuring the rights and freedoms of minors in the country, the safety of minors in society and family is still not maintained. According to statistics from the competent government bodies, the number of crimes against the sexual integrity of minors is still not decreasing. A special category of minors are children with disabilities.  Children with disabilities are at very high risk of becoming victims of sexual violence. However, due to the low likelihood of being reported to law enforcement agencies, crimes committed against children in this category remain latent. At the same time, effective solutions are proposed to improve the prevention of criminal offenses against the sexual integrity of minors.
